Web1 jan. 2024 · Generally, the statute of limitations for tax return audits is three years. For example, the IRS would have until April 15, 2016 to assess additional tax on a business that files a 2012 tax return on April 15, 2013. However, the IRS can reach back six years if a business erroneously fails to report more than 25 percent of its gross income ... WebWhat is the IRS 6 year rule? 6 years - If you don't report income that you should have reported, and it's more than 25% of the gross income shown on the return, or it's attributable to foreign financial assets and is more than $5,000, the time to assess tax is 6 years from the date you filed the return. Web13 jan. 2024 · The IRS can include returns from the past three years in an audit. It generally has three years to assess additional taxes as well. It can request an extension to that statute of limitations, but you don't have to agree. The IRS can also go back further if they find certain errors, although it doesn't usually go back more than the last six years.
